These Are 6 Perfectly Good Reasons Why Your Dog Should Sleep in Your Bed

There’s a debate that rages on in households over whether or not the family dog should be allowed to sleep on the bed. And there are compelling arguments to be made on both sides.

But while the non-bed people may have their hygiene or “the bed is too small for all of us” reasons, this quick list of reasons why your pooch should sleep on your bed shows that allowing them to cuddle with you can have huge benefits for everybody involved.

  1. Dogs can help fight insomnia by helping a person feel warm and safe.

  2. Snuggling dogs helps to relieve anxiety and stress.
  3. Dogs have been known to help fight depression because they often love their owner unconditionally.
  4. Due to their warm body and rhythmic breathing, dogs are comfortable sleeping companions.
  5. Additionally, their warm bodies can help keep their owners warm on cold nights. (But get us started on summer nights though.)
  6. Sleeping with their human is also good for the dog’s well-being as they too feel safe and secure by your side.
